Rhino Posted March 12, 2007 Report Share Posted March 12, 2007 Re: Doe before Buck Never heard of a state that required that. I know of one hunting club that used to do that. After a few years of complaints from members loosing opportunities, they changed that rule to require that 1st doe to be killed by a certain date. That at least gave them the opportunity to pick the time to kill that 1st doe rather than let a shooter buck walk. I know of several clubs that require their members to kill at least 1 doe for every buck they kill. They have the whole season to get it done though. Randy Posted March 12, 2007 Report Share Posted March 12, 2007 Re: Doe before Buck Wisconsin has certain "deer management units" That have "earn a buck" rules. In EAB units you must shoot a antlerless deer before shooting a buck. It's not a bad deal because if you shoot a antlerless deer you receive a sticker which COULD be used for the following year. For instance, I shot 7 antlerless deer this last season so I received my two buck stickers for next season, one for gun, one for bow. Now come opening day of bow season I can shoot a bruiser right away!! If you did not shoot an antlerless deer last year you will have to pass on the bucks until you do.
